Engine Inlet Guide Vane Ice Impact Fragmentation
Abstract
Experimental testing and analytical modeling of ice impact and fragmentation at turbo fan engine inlet were conducted in this research. A rotor testing facility, Adverse Environment Rotor Test Stand (AERTS) Laboratory, was introduced to reproduce natural icing condition and representative ice shapes typically found on engine inlet guide vanes.
